Weak Legacy 2 Breathing Tier List
Each breathing style keeps its canonical name. The ranking reasons explain where it shines in both PvE and PvP. Use this alongside the Weapon Tier List to sync your build.
| Breathing Style | PvP & PvE Ranking Reasons |
|---|---|
| Moon Breathing | Top PvE DPS with Crimson Lineage rotations that melt bosses, while counter tools keep PvP duels honest if you master animation cancel windows. |
| Sun Breathing | Fast startup and mobility-heavy strings dominate PvP; V2 adds burst windows that still roast raid mobs when you need AoE. |
| Insect Breathing | Rework granted fresh stunlock chains and Bee Mode pressure, making it a budget-friendly PvP terror with reliable boss shredding. |
| Mist Breathing | Sea of Clouds dash + burn variant turned Mist into a PvE clearing machine while maintaining evasive mix-ups for smaller arenas. |
| Water Breathing | Once you unlock V2, Dead Calm plus the mobility kit offer a flexible answer to both dungeon waves and ladder matches. |
| Thunder Breathing | Lightning-speed movement and tech-heavy combos reward aggressive players in both grinding routes and ranked queues. |
| Flower Breathing | Vermillion Eye auto-dodge strings punish hyper-aggressive opponents while providing enough sustain for co-op raids. |
| Flame Breathing | Huge AOE fans for early-game grinding; pair it with Rengoku lineage to offset the slower PvP start-ups. |
| Sound Breathing | Late-game burst potential with String Performance and Uzui clan synergy gives it staying power across modes. |
Weak Legacy 2 Blood Demon Art Tier List
Blood Demon Arts often fill the gaps your breathing set leaves behind. Mix and match with clans from the Clan Tier List for extra synergy.
| Blood Demon Arts | PvP & PvE Ranking Reasons |
|---|---|
| Cryokinesis | Spammable low-cooldown kit, Frozen Lotus unblockable, and Lotus Vine mobility keep it S-tier for raids and duels alike. |
| Obi Manipulation | Pulverizing Obi covers entire arenas, while Assault starters and sweeping AOEs make it a staple for PvP pressure. |
| Emotion Manifestation | Slow start but 85+ mastery unlocks Ascetic Blaze mix-ups and Wind Blast pokes that shred both players and bosses. |
| Arrow Manipulation | Remote pulls, instant-hit dive bombs, and Arrow Spikes poke allow zoning playstyles with ridiculous consistency. |
| Destructive Death | Unblockable chains and aerial mobility make it a nightmare in PvP while still farming crystals efficiently. |
| String | String Slash guardbreak into arena-sized finishers grants a balanced toolkit for squads that swap between PvE and PvP. |
| Exploding Blood | Massive AOE carpets and generous hitboxes ease PvE grinding; time the stuns carefully for niche PvP value. |
| Blood Sickle | Rewarding once you learn the M1 into Rampage chains; excels in PvE where enemies cannot dodge your arcs. |
| Hiasobi Temari | Premier kiting BDA—long range balls melt raid bosses, but aggressive players can interrupt it in PvP. |
| Dream Manipulation | Great progression pick thanks to high damage pulses, though its shorter range requires positioning discipline in duels. |
